Use the information to solve the triangle. Round your answers to two decimal places. Hint: draw a sketch first to determine if y

ou should use Law of Sines or Cosines.
B=104°, C=33°, a=18.1

Answer:

A = 43°

b = 25.8 (3 sig. fig.)

c = 14.5 (3 sig. fig.)

Step-by-step explanation:

Using angle sum of triangle, we get A = 180 - 104 - 33 = 43°

Using sin law,

b/sin104 = 18.1/sin43

b = 25.8 (3 sig. fig.)

c/sin33 = 18.1/sin43

c = 14.5 (3 sig. fig.)
